15 Defect &Liability Period The contractor shall be responsible to make good and remedy at his
own expense any defect which may develop or may be noticed
before the period mentioned hereunder from the certified date of
completion, The within 15 days of receipt of the notice. In the case of
failure on the part of the contractor, the Engineer-in-charge may
rectify or remove or re-execute the work at the risk & cost of the
contractor. The Engineer-in-charge shall be entitled to appropriate
the whole or any part of the amount of security deposit towards the
expenses, if any, Incurred by him in rectification, removal or re-
execution. The Defects Liability period shall be as under(a) for all
works costing upto Rs. 50,000 ( amount put to tender), the period
shall be 3 months from the certified date of completion.
(b) for all works costing more than Rs. 50,000 and upto Rs. 1 crore
(amount put tender), the period shall be 6 months from the certified
date of completion or one monsoon, whichever is later.
(c) for major projects costing more than Rs. 1 crore, the period shall
be 12 months from the certified date of completion which should
include one monsoon.
(d) For building works, the period specified in (a), (b) or (c) above OR
elapse of monsoon period following the certified date of completion,
whichever is later. For the purpose of deciding the monsoon period,
the 30th September may be treated as the last date.

SLA Breach and Penalty Clause for Road & Footpath Complaints
1. Complaint Resolution within SLA:
The Contractor/ Agency shall attend to and completely resolve all complaints related to Road and Footpath works
within the prescribed Service Level Agreement (SLA) time limit mentioned in the tender. The SLA period shall be
calculated from the date and time of registration/allotment of the complaint.
2. SLA for Road & Footpath Complaints:

3. Penalty for Breach of SLA:
If any complaint is not completely resolved within the prescribed SLA period, the same shall be treated
as SLA Breach and the applicable penalty mentioned above shall be imposed on the Contractor/Agency.
4. Additional Penalty for Continued Delay:
If the complaint remains unresolved even after expiry of the SLA period, the applicable penalty shall be
recovered for every additional 24 hours or part thereof until the complaint is completely rectified and
verified by the concerned Engineer/authorized officer.
5. Actual Resolution and Verification:
Temporary barricading, placing of material, or initiation of work shall not be considered as resolution of
the complaint. The complaint shall be considered closed only after the required work is completed and
the same is verified by the concerned Engineer/authorized officer.
6. No Exemption on Account of Delay:
The Contractor/Agency shall not claim exemption from penalty merely on the ground that the work has
been started. In case the complaint continues to remain unresolved beyond the prescribed SLA, penalty
shall continue to accrue until satisfactory completion of the work.
7. Recovery of Penalty:
The penalty amount shall be recovered from the Contractor's running bill/final bill/security deposit or
any other amount payable to the Contractor by the Municipal Corporation, without prejudice to any
other action permissible under the tender/contract conditions.
8. Reopened/Unsatisfactory Complaints:
If a complaint is closed without satisfactory rectification and is subsequently reopened by the
complainant, the same shall be treated as an unresolved complaint and the applicable SLA/penalty
provisions shall continue to apply.
9. Repeated Delay:
In case of repeated failure to resolve complaints within the prescribed SLA, the Municipal Corporation
shall have the right to issue a warning/show-cause notice and take further contractual action, including
withholding of payment, recovery of additional expenditure, or other action as per the terms and
conditions of the tender.
10. Exceptional Circumstances:
Any extension of SLA shall be considered only in genuine circumstances beyond the control of the
Contractor and shall require prior approval Engineer In-charge. No extension shall be considered
merely due to shortage of labour, machinery, materials, traffic arrangements or other resources under
the Contractor's responsibility.
